FAQs About Unnamed WA33799 Nature Reserve

What is the best season to walk in Unnamed WA33799 Nature Reserve in Beachlands, Australia?

The best season for walking in Unnamed WA33799 Nature Reserve in Beachlands, Australia is typically during the autumn and spring months when the weather is milder and more comfortable for outdoor activities.

What are the typical weather conditions to prepare for in Unnamed WA33799 Nature Reserve in Beachlands, Australia?

In Unnamed WA33799 Nature Reserve in Beachlands, Australia, you should prepare for warm and dry summers with temperatures reaching up to 35°C, as well as mild and wet winters with temperatures averaging around 15°C. It's important to bring sun protection and stay hydrated during the hot summer months.

What kind of wildlife might you encounter in Unnamed WA33799 Nature Reserve in Beachlands, Australia?

While walking in Unnamed WA33799 Nature Reserve in Beachlands, Australia, you may encounter a variety of wildlife including kangaroos, wallabies, various bird species, and reptiles such as lizards and snakes. It's important to respect their natural habitat and observe from a safe distance.
